Assessing Surface Area Conditions



Assessing surface area problems is vital prior to diving into external painting for an industrial building.


Beginning by evaluating the surfaces thoroughly. Look for signs of wear, such as peeling paint, splits, or mold and mildew. You'll want to identify any kind of areas that require repair work; if left unaddressed, these problems can compromise the new paint job.

Next, examine the substrate material. Different products, like wood, steel, or stucco, might call for certain treatments or repairs. For example, deteriorating timber needs changing, while rusted steel could call for sanding and priming.

Lastly, evaluate the sanitation of the surface areas. Dirt, oil, and crud can prevent paint from adhering appropriately. A thorough cleaning usually saves you money and time in the future.

Picking Materials and Tools



Picking the right products and tools is vital for an effective external painting project on a commercial structure. Search for exterior paints that offer resilience and UV resistance. If you're dealing with wood, pick a paint particularly made for that material to prevent peeling or blistering.

Next, gather the essential tools. A sturdy ladder or scaffolding is vital for reaching higher locations safely. Purchase good-quality brushes and rollers; these will certainly offer much better coverage and a smoother finish. Do not neglect to pick up a paint sprayer if you're taking on big surface areas, as it can save time and make sure an even application.

Furthermore, consider safety equipment like gloves and masks to make certain safety and security while working. You may also require ground cloth to protect the ground and bordering areas from paint splatters.

Ensuring Conformity and Safety



Prior to beginning your exterior painting job, it's vital to make certain conformity with local policies and safety standards.

Begin by contacting your local government for any kind of licenses called for to undertake your painting task. Some locations may have limitations on the kinds of materials you can utilize or certain guidelines for shade choice.

Next, acquaint on your own with safety and security requirements that put on commercial buildings. This includes making sure that your worksite is devoid of risks. Set up appropriate obstacles and signs to keep pedestrians and employees risk-free from any type of prospective crashes.

If your building is high, ensure you have the ideal scaffolding or ladders that meet safety laws.

Additionally, consider environmental regulations concerning paint disposal and drainage. Usage eco-friendly paints whenever feasible, which can lower your influence on the environment and ensure compliance with local laws.

Finally, if you're working with service providers, confirm that they have actually the necessary licenses and insurance coverage. This not only safeguards you but also makes certain that they follow safety and security methods.
